Sounds alright. If you can get the R4 DS cheaper, get that, since they're identical. M3 Simply's firmware is the same as R4's, but appears some days later.

You won't need a PassCard3 for the M3 Lite, your M3 Simply can act as one (to boot it in NDS mode). M3 Lite is an excellent choice for GBA and Opera RAM.

Sandisk Ultra II's are good, but pricey. Japanese Kingstons are highly popular and very good. They come cheap in the US, and currently DealExtreme is selling the 1GB Japanese models for 14 bucks including airmail shipping to anywhere in the world. I received one and they're genuine.

The 2GB Ultra II will work fine I think, except Castlevania PoR may crash. SuperCardShop is a good UK based online shop I think. Not sure if they carry all you want.
